Nevsun Recommends Shareholders Take No Immediate Action in Response to Unsolicited Takeover Bid by Lundin Mining

2018-07-26 / @newswire

 

VANCOUVER, July 26, 2018 /CNW/ - Nevsun Resources Ltd. (TSX:NSU) (NYSE AMERICAN: NSU) ("Nevsun" or the "Company") today acknowledged that it has received an unsolicited offer (the "Offer") from Lundin Mining Corporation ("Lundin") to acquire all of the issued and outstanding shares of Nevsun.

Nevsun shareholders are advised to take no action until the Board of Directors has made a formal recommendation to shareholders. The Offer will remain open for a minimum of 105 days, allowing Nevsun shareholders until November 9, 2018 to respond.

The Offer follows an announcement by Lundin on July 16, 2018 of its intention to make an offer for Nevsun. At that time, Nevsun indicated that Lundin's announcement ignored the fundamental value of Nevsun.  Lundin has also ignored the recent improvements at the Bisha mine, the new ultra-large Timok Lower Zone resource and progress at the Timok Upper Zone project. These achievements have set the stage for further value enhancement, and attracted the attention of several strategic parties that have expressed an interest in participating in the Company's continued development.

Having now received a formal Offer, the special committee of independent Nevsun directors (the "Special Committee") will consider it with its advisors before making a recommendation to Nevsun's Board of Directors.  Nevsun's Board will make a formal recommendation to shareholders via a Director's Circular within 15 days, in accordance with Canadian securities regulations.

About Nevsun Resources Ltd.

Nevsun Resources Ltd. is the 100% owner of the high-grade copper-gold Timok Upper Zone and 60.4% owner of the Timok Lower Zone in Serbia. The Timok Lower Zone is a partnership with Freeport-McMoRan Exploration Corporation ("Freeport"), which currently owns 39.6% and upon completion of any feasibility study, Nevsun Resources Ltd. will own 46% and Freeport will own 54%. Nevsun generates cash flow from its 60% owned copper-zinc Bisha Mine in Eritrea.  Nevsun is well positioned with a strong debt-free balance sheet to grow shareholder value through advancing Timok to production.
